Subject: Quickstore 4.2 — bloom filter now fronts the KV layer

Plugin authors: starting with this release, Quickstore places a bloom filter ahead of the key-value store. Negative lookups return faster; false positives fall through safely. No API changes are required on your side. Verify your plugin against the staging build referenced below.

session token of fahif-tadup = htk3_9c7

## PortionPal Scaling Issues

If a customer says scaled quantities look wrong, first check whether they switched unit systems mid-recipe — that's the usual culprit. The calculator rounds to kitchen-friendly fractions, so tiny ingredients (under a quarter teaspoon) may clamp to a minimum. That's expected, not a bug. Anything beyond that, grab the recipe ID and the scale factor they used, then file a ticket. The triage checklist is on our internal page.

runbook for hawif-tajeg: https://grafana.plorvasoft.example/dash

## Artifact signing — Relayer ORM refactor

As discussed in last week's sync, all builds from the ormx-refactor branch now go through the standard Corvid signing pipeline. The legacy ORM shim and the new repository layer ship in the same artifact until cutover, so both must pass signature verification in CI. Unsigned artifacts are blocked from the staging registry. Rotation cadence matches mainline: every 90 days. For verification during review, the branch signing key is listed below.

release key, fahaf-bajof: bky3_Xam

## Formula sandbox tuning

User-supplied formulas in Gridmoor execute inside a restricted interpreter with hard ceilings on time, memory, and call depth. Reviewers should confirm any change to these ceilings is justified in the PR description, since raising them widens the abuse surface. Defaults were chosen from production traces. The current limits are as follows.

limits module of tafog-fawip:
WEIGHTS = {
    "julix": 57,
    "lamys": 992,
    "kasvan": 209,
    "quenok": 750,
    "alddor": 259,
    "oliath": 1009,
    "wenix": 815,
}

Reviewing Crumbline's order-cutoff logic? Orders placed after 14:00 local roll to the next bake day; the cutoff is enforced in cutoff.ts, not the UI. Reject any PR that duplicates the rule client-side. Test fixtures live in the sealed config bundle for the Millbrae store. To open that bundle during review, use the recovery passphrase provided below.

unlock words, hahip-yagef: zorok-novmir-zorix-silax